Document ArchivePolicy on Feral PigsAdopted March 1989 (PDF Version) Feral pig (Sus scrofa) populations are rapidly increasing their range in California. Agricultural crops and native plant and wildlife habitats are severely damaged by the activities of these pig populations. Because of this threat to California's resources CNPS urges public agencies to establish policies and programs to halt the spread of feral pigs and to minimize the damage they cause.
